246-TRICHLOROANISOLE
Basic information
- Chemical formula(s): \({\rm C_7H_5Cl_3O}\)
- Other names: 1,3,5-trichloro-2-methoxybenzene, 2,4,6-trichloromethoxybenzene, TCA, tyrene
- CAS: 87-40-1

NFPA 704 (fire diamond)

- Health (blue): 2 - intense or continued but not chronic exposure could cause temporary incapacitation or possible residual injury.
- Flammability (red): 0 - will not burn under typical fire conditions, will not burn in air unless exposed to a temperature of 820 °C for more than 5 minutes.
- Instability–reactivity (yellow): 0 - normally stable, even under fire exposure conditions, and is not reactive with water.

Hazard statements
| Code | Phrase |
|---|---|
| H302 | harmful if swallowed |
| H319 | causes serious eye irritation |
| H413 | may cause long lasting harmful effects to aquatic life |

Protective measures
Gloves
Occupational Safety and Health Act of 1970 and OSHA Glove Selection Chart do not provide recommendation on gloves for handling 2,4,6-trichloroanisole. Sigma Aldrich provides the following information:
- Neoprene: N/A
- Natural latex or rubber: N/A
- Buthyl: N/A
- Nitrile: very good protection; 480 min breakthrough time for 0.11 mm thickness.
